    OK, I just went to the Smithing Guild and talked to the NPCs, and my ranges were way off. My Smithing skill is 57. The highest recipe that Hugues, the free support NPC, would give me was level 61, meaning a range of 1 to 4. The highest recipe that Wise Owl, the advanced support NPC, gave me was 66 and the lowest was 62, meaning a range of 5 to 9. If this pattern holds true for over 100 (no reason why it shouldn't) hexed gear will cap between 105 and 109. The only cooking recipe that I cannot get at 100.9 is Himesama Rice Ball, which I would guess is 110 skill. I need to just try to get that last 0.1 to see if it shows up in the advance support NPC listing.
    Some more data on this: I just cranked through this process with my level 87 blacksmithing mule. Free support npc gave me 88-91 synths, for a +1-+4 range as expected, but the (disturbing galka) advanced support npc gave me 92-97 recipes, for a +5-+10 range, one more than he did for you at 57. Oddly, he only gave me about half of the available 97 recipes, even though I spammed him enough to get all of the 92-96 recipes. The mule is 87.6, but I'd prefer not to think that the recipe suggestion npcs take partial levels into account somehow. Anyway, this may mean that at 100 we're already being shown all recipes up to 110, and at the least it's going to make nailing down some of the higher-end recipes' exact levels take a little more paranoia.

    Makes me wonder if the suggestion range shrinks at low levels, not that it really matters for anything.

    Tested Goldsmithing guild with Atum. Atum has a level 2 goldsmithing skill, Wulfnoth gave him recipes between 3 and 6, Fatimah gave him recipes between 7 and 12. So it seems that the ranges do not scale and I just got unlucky when I was spamming Wise Owl for recipes. (I talked to him a good 40-50 times.) Will be useful for nailing down ranges.

    Current theory is that the list npc gives everything up to your current cap, NQ support npc gives recipes 1-4 levels above you, and HQ support npc gives recipes 5-10 levels above you. Random old recipes can be missing from any of them for unknown-but-probably-sloppiness-related reasons.

    My lazy smithing skillup path is:

    60->66 : Negoroshiki - If no one has bombed the Tenshudo since the last update and your fame is good(?), this will NPC there for 18k each. The price takes forever to recover, so bomb the NPCs one at a time. My experience is that Bastok can take 30, Tenshodo can take ~40, and Jeuno can take ~50. One rotation of them got me to 64, but I sold some to other NPCs as well (12300 gil). I approximately broke even on this synth.

    66->72 : Darksteel Pick - Classic NPC synth. They go for 12k. Profit or break even.

    I apologize for the necrobump, but I wanted to mention another couple good options to get Smithing to 70.

    Darksteel Cap - I believe the cap on this is 72 with a Leather sub in the mid 30s. When I leveled in the 50s I saved all the Darksteel Sheets I had made and used them here. I bought the stacks of Tiger Leather. This is a really good option for those who either have Bonecraft main, or have a LS member with Bonecraft main. This is the main ingredient for making Hecatomb Caps. Since they are now T1, Bonecrafters will buy these in mass quantities whenever they attempt to HQ some Heca Caps.

    I sold each one to a LS friend for 25k each. Though they currently (on Shiva) go for 40k at AH. You can sell at that price and make more profit, but at 25k you will make your money back from the Darksteel synths in the 50s.
